First Update for Backwards Compatibility Available

>> Xbox.com has been updated with info on how to get the latest emulation drivers on your Xbox 360. The first update, branded "November 2005", allows to play all the original Xbox games on the list Microsoft released 2 weeks ago.

There are 3 ways to get this update:

* Update through Xbox Live.

* Burn a DVD or CD.

* Order a disc by mail from Xbox.com (available early December).

The 2nd option could certainly be interesting to learn more about the system. You can download the file here[xbox.com].

The zip-file contains one 2.5MB .xex file (which will give BC-support for over 200 games!), that's an Xbox 360 executable (like .xbe for the original Xbox). Once burned on CD-R or DVD+-R you'll be able to run the update on your 360 from the CD/DVD.
